- One of the night sky’s brightest stars may have been hiding a secret
Astronomers have found clear evidence of a faint companion star, Betelgeuse B, orbiting the red supergiant Betelgeuse in Orion. Using the European Southern Observatory’s Very Large Telescope, researchers detected the companion, which is more massive than previously predicted, potentially explaining Betelgeuse’s unusual behavior and offering insights into its eventual supernova.
